A Tutorial on the LTE-V2X Direct Communication

Abstract

The concept of direct communications between vehicles and to/from vehicles and roadside infrastructure (vehicle to vehicle and vehicle to infrastructure-V2X) has been around for more than 20 years. With the specification of direct communication in the 3GPP, a new V2X technology has emerged with the global telecommunications specification efforts. This technology, formally known as PC5 Sidelink, but commonly called LTE-V2X (or sometimes C-V2X) is initially based on Release 14 of 3GPP, enabling those long-envisioned use cases to be delivered with a different, mainstreamed radio access technology. This paper summarizes how LTE-V2X works, describes the standard activities in different layers of LTE-V2X protocol stack for US deployment, and showcases the performance of LTE-V2X in variety of real-world driving scenarios.
